If it’s not grown, it must be mined. Our societies rely heavily on the supply of metals and minerals. From copper to aluminium; from plastic to cement; mining is all around us.  Yet, mining is not loved - to say the least.  Are the extractives good or bad?  In this episode, we are joined by Tony Addison, recently appointed Professor in Economics at the Development Economics Research Group (University of Copenhagen), and formerly Chief Economist of UNU-WIDER.  We discuss how to assess what the industry is doing for us - including the good, the bad and the ugly.***Highgrade is a not-for-profit media company that produces interviews and documentaries that identify, capture and disseminate analysis and insights in the field of natural resources and social progress.
